Heading from Yogyakarta to Purwokerto where I met my brother who joined me from Bandung. It’s a very kind of him to take over the wheel from Purwokerto,Central Java to our final destination : Bandung, West Java – knowing that Bart must be exhausted after 3 days on the road.
Purwokerto for me is a city with memory of my childhood visiting grandparents house, this means : lots of good food and laughter. I still have my aunt living in this city today. Like any other city in the country, the javanese culture moves parallel with the modernity and development. It is the capital of Banyumas Regency, Central Java region, Purwokerto is located near the base of Mount Slamet, the highest volcano in Central Java.

This year’s marathon event was held on 18 October 2009, Sunday, 6:00 A.M. at Nusa Dua, Bali , Indonesia with GARUDA INDONESIA as its Official Event Presentor, and offers Half Marathon (21.0975KM), 10K and 5K with several categories. The Organizing Committee has planned it to become an annual marathon event with the aim of offering full 42KM Marathon (can you that, Bart?!) by next year and reverting to its original schedule of every 3 rd Sunday of October for its succeeding stages starting 2009. The Organizers have also applied for recognition with the Association of International Marathons (AIMS) with the view of becoming a distinguished annual marathon event at par with other international marathon events in the Asia-Pacific Region ( source : http://www.garudabalimarathon.com/event ).

My almost 2 hours road trip with Bart this time is to the east of Bali, to Karangasem Regency. Destination: Water Palace Taman Ujung Soekasada. Not many people in Bali or coming to Bali wants to visit this place for its distance that is far from main tourist spots and I have to admit it is so crazy hot there specially if you come after 10am.
No wonder some professional photographers we met were just on their way back to the parking lot at 10am, exactly the time of our arrival, as they began shooting the place at 5 o’clock in the morning! So my suggestion, come around 7am when it’s cooler and you can avoid the heat.
Taman Ujung Soekasada was the residence of Karangasem Royal Family between 1909 and 1945. It was built in 1919 by the late King of Karangasem, I Gusti Bagus Jelantik. The King of Karangasem Djelantik with his wives (yes, plural..) and children lived here, and it is also their proud place to welcome royal guests from other regions and even countries. It is very interesting to look at their private rooms with old style traditional bed, old family photos hang on the walls.

Taking theme this year : The New Spirit of Heritage – Marine Life, Sanur Village Festival had taken place from 12 – 16 August 2009, along Sanur Beach coastal area, starting from Pantai Matahari Terbit (the Sunrise Beach), to the main area of festival : Mertasari Beach. Yes, in Sanur, there are several beach access with its own name on each village. Sanur has been known as its laid back atmosphere, from sunrise till sunset, there is no loud ‘house’ music, drunken tourists on the street, annoying freelance illegal guides offering expensive villa membership we will never use, nor t-shirtless surfers on motorbike wearing no helmet – usual scenes you can always witness in Kuta or Seminyak.
